What is Contractubex and how does it work?

Contractubex is a topical ointment used to treat scars and promote wound healing. It contains natural ingredients like onion extract and heparin that help reduce inflammation, promote collagen production, and soften and flatten raised scars.

Mechanism of action of Contractubex

Contractubex is a gel containing plant-based ingredients that promote wound healing and reduce the appearance of scars through its anti-inflammatory, antibacterial, and collagen-stimulating properties, supporting the natural healing process.

How should Contractubex be taken and in what dosage?

Contractubex is a topical gel applied directly to the skin. Apply a thin layer of Contractubex to the affected area 2-3 times daily until fully healed. Follow these steps:

1. Clean and dry the affected area.
2. Apply a thin layer of Contractubex.
3. Gently massage it into the skin.
4. Repeat application 2-3 times daily.

Contraindications for the use of Contractubex

Contractubex should not be used in individuals with hypersensitivity to any of its components. It is also contraindicated in open wounds, third-degree burns, and during pregnancy and lactation. Contraindications include:

– Hypersensitivity to any component
– Open wounds
– Third-degree burns
– Pregnancy
– Lactation

Possible side effects of Contractubex

Contractubex is generally well-tolerated, but some minor side effects may occur. These include:

  • Skin irritation or redness
  • Itching or burning sensation
  • Temporary discoloration of the skin

If you experience any severe or persistent side effects, it’s recommended to consult with your healthcare provider. Most side effects are mild and resolve on their own after discontinuing the product.
